HTC Legend in Canada: Available Now on Virgin Mobile, Coming June 16th to Bell

The Virgin Mobile HTC LegendHappy Sunday all! I just had to do a quick update on the HTC Legend for all of the Canadian mobile junkies out there. You may recall a few days ago I mentioned the Virgin Mobile HTC Legend was available. While the new Android 2.1 (Eclair) powered device wasn’t available online at the time, it is now, and is ready for your Android-lovin’ hands. You can check it out right here.

Pricing on the Virgin Mobile HTC Legend sits at $79.99 on a 3-year term, or $349.99 on a month-to-month basis. Not too shabby if I do say so myself. The only bummer here is for folks in Saskatchewan and Manitoba. Yes, due to ‘network differences’ the Legend isn’t available in your province yet. We’ve heard this before, haven’t we?

That’s all well and good but I can already hear some of you saying ‘OK cool, that covers Virgin Mobile, but what about Bell?’. Nothing has changed on that front. As far as we know, the Bell HTC Legend is still slated for a June 16th release network-wide. I’ve made a little note in my calendar, so I’ll be sure to give you an update as the launch nears!

Key features of the HTC Legend include:

  • aluminum unibody construction (very nice)
  • Android 2.1 ‘Eclair’
  • HTC’s Sense UI
  • optical trackpad
  • 3.2 capacitive AMOLED display (320×480)
  • 5 megapixel camera with video
  • 3.5 mm headset jack
  • 600Mhz Qualcomm processor
  • 3G
  • WiFi
  • GPS
  • Bluetooth 2.1
  • micro-USB
  • expansion to 32GB via microSD

A nice, tidy feature set for sure… and for anyone out there looking to upgrade from the Hero… Well, yeah, this is a nice update for sure (especially the jump to Android 2.1).
